## Ownership

This module handles backpressure for the Pushloom notification fan-out. Queue depth limits, shed policy, and retry budgets are defined in `backpressure.yaml`. Do not tune limits without load-test evidence. Incidents page the on-call; design changes require owner review. Contractors: open a proposal doc first. All changes route through the owner named below.

signatory, fahof-bagag: Wenath Novys

Minutes — Management Meeting, Varnelo Group

Present: R. Ostwick (Chair), L. Femmers, D. Quale.

The revised sales-commission scheme was approved. Base commission drops to 4%, with accelerators above 110% of quota. Clawbacks apply to cancellations within 90 days. Femmers confirmed payroll systems can implement by next quarter. Quale to brief regional leads in Harlowe Bay. Objections from the field team were noted and dismissed as transitional friction. Rollout communications are embargoed until board sign-off. Details of the plan follow below.

confidential, yagep-kagef: Rusvanox Holdings is in early talks to buy Julwynix Systems for about $454.5 million. The Fenael launch date is April 23, and nothing goes to the press before then. Legal wants the Druwynix Works term sheet redrafted before January 8.

Meeting notes, Validator Plugin Working Group. We agreed the Checkpost plugin system will load validators from a signed manifest at startup; hot-reload is deferred until sandboxing lands. Each plugin must declare its schema version, and mismatches fail closed rather than skipping validation. On-call should know: a failing plugin blocks the whole ingest queue by design, so do not disable validation to clear a backlog. Escalate plugin failures to the responsible engineer named below.

named custodian: Brivan Eliath Quenox Frador

## Artifact Signing — RestockPilot

All RestockPilot planner builds must be signed before the vending-machine restock scheduler will accept them. CI signs automatically on tagged commits; manual builds require the CLI signer. Verify with `rpctl verify` before upload. Rotation happens quarterly — check this page each cycle. The active signing key for the current quarter is below.

signing key of bagap-yawep = bky13_TbfT6ZMUoGJo2